Undergraduate Tuition & Fees

The following table compares 2023-2024 undergraduate tuition & fees between selected colleges. The average undergraduate tuition & fees is $36,461 for all students. The 2023-2024 undergraduate tuition & fees of selected colleges are increased by 4.78% compared to the previous year.
Among the selected colleges, Pratt Institute-Main requires the most expensive tuition & fees of $59,683 and Sh'or Yoshuv Rabbinical College has the lowest tuition & fees of $11,700 for undergraduate programs.
Undergraduate Tuition & Fess Comparison Between Selected Colleges
Name2022-20232023-2024
In-StateOut-of-StateIn-StateOut-of-State
Albany Medical College This school does not have undergraduate programs.
Keuka College $36,191$38,000
Pratt Institute-Main $57,599$59,683
Sh'or Yoshuv Rabbinical College $10,600$11,700
New York Academy of Art The undergraduate tuition information is not available.
Average$34,797$36,461
